Enemies of Innovation:

  • Failure: Innovative thinkers see mistakes as invaluable sources of information. Refusing to take risks or make decisions that could result in failure prevents us from generating new ideas.
  • Complacency: Past successes can lead us to believe that we do not need to seek new and improved solutions. “If it ain’t broke, don’t fix it,” is a perspective that halts progress and prevents us from breathing new life into our work.
  • Maintaining the Status Quo: When we focus exclusively on maintaining the current processes and approaches, we will spend all of our time and resources on sustaining the old. Innovation requires prioritizing and making time for creative thinking and breaking new ground.
